To complete this activity, take a walk with your baby around the house and show him or her what happens when you turn on a light switch, ring the doorbell, or pull on a drawer's handle. you, watch your child closely — I'd love to hear what you notice about how they responds.
Watch for: Baby test cause and effect by dropping an object and seeing if you'll pick it up.
